There are three main types of camping available in BC Parks Frontcountry Backcountry Group Frontcountry ‘Frontcountry’ means an area within 1km of a park road or a highway. Of the 10,700 campsites BC Parks manages, approximately 55% are reservable and 45% remain available on a first come, first served basis.
